Elijah Molden’s Resonant Impact and Contract Details
Elijah Molden’s extension, valued at $18.75 million over three years, underscores the Chargers’ recognition of his invaluable contributions to the team. Molden’s exceptional performance on the field has not gone unnoticed, as he emerged as a linchpin in the Chargers’ defensive setup. Acquired from the Tennessee Titans in a calculated trade masterminded by general manager Joe Hortiz, Molden seamlessly integrated into the Chargers’ defensive scheme, showcasing his prowess with 75 tackles and three interceptions in his debut season.
Strategic Defensive Reshuffling and Molden’s Role
The Chargers’ astute decision to transition Molden to the safety position brought about a tactical shift, enabling defensive flexibility by deploying Derwin James in a versatile nickel corner role. Molden’s adaptability and skill set not only enhanced the team’s defensive strategies but also laid the foundation for a dynamic and multifaceted defensive unit. Despite a season-ending injury in Week 17, Molden’s resilience and potential as a starting safety position him as a cornerstone for the Chargers’ defensive blueprint.
